Tennis

Tennis is a game played between two single players, in the singles game, or two teams of two players each, in the doubles game. To play, the players use a strung racquet to hit the tennis ball and send it over the net into the opponent's court. The purpose of the game is to send the ball fairly into the opponent's court in such a way that the opponent cannot return it fairly into your own court. This would include not being able to return it at all, causing the opponent to return it low and into the net, or returning it outside of the boundaries of your own court. The game is played all over the world, professionally and by amateurs. The simplicity of the game makes it possible for anyone who can hold a racquet, including those in wheelchairs and the very old and very young, to participate.
